Nagare: “That damn Ryoma! I can’t believe this guy! Just leaving me hanging like that!”
As much as he tried to be cool-headed, Nagare couldn’t help but growl in agitation.
Carrying an injured person with him was out of question, so Nagare asked the villagers to take care of the guy they rescued from the monster butcher. Hopefully that guy would regain consciousness by the time this mess could be dealt with.
While he liked to consider himself to be a man with ice-like demeanor, in reality, Nagare was as volatile as a volcano.
Now he was investigating the orcs alone, with only the silver sword by his side.
Nagare: “Aren’t we supposed to be partners, Shoyo? What kind of partner leaves his comrade and runs off on his own?”
Yep, next time he sees him, Nagare will definitely punch Shoyo in the face.
He called himself a Yaksha, but Nagare suspected that Shoyo was just a weirdo who suffered from delusions of grandeur. Who wouldn’t if he possessed such regenerative ability?
Demons can continuously regenerate, without any limitations. If it were not for their vulnerability to Holy element, silver, or sunlight, there would have been no way of fighting them.
In Shoyo’s case, he was not vulnerable to any of demon weaknesses, but his regenerative ability was nowhere near as strong. If anything, he was closer to a lizard.
Following the villagers’ directions, Nagare ended up stumbling upon the grounds of a battlefield.
Bodies of many green monsters lay there, each one beheaded.
Orcs.
Creatures that possessed intellect comparable to humans and acted in groups.
They were comparable to goblins, but unlike them, Orcs were far more powerful and dangerous fighters.
Bodies of humans were there too, each one ripped ashred to the point they were nigh-unrecognizable.
From the looks of it, about 5 humans.
Advertisement
According to the villagers, there were 5 Demon Hunters and one Guardian.
Nagare: “This looks pretty bad. They managed to kill many orcs, but they lost their lives in the process. I wonder if one of the bodies belongs to that Guardian…”
While the five human bodies were located here among the corpses of slain orcs, the trail of dead orcs just continued on stretching from there, with many of their disembodied heads covering the area.
Nagare: ‘I see. So five of them lost their lives with the first wave, but someone managed to push them back and keep fighting….’
Following this trail led Nagare to the opening of a cave.
Ready for anything, Nagare readied his sword, anticipating a surprise attack.
But much to his surprise, he saw a form of a man, sitting over a bonfire.
From the looks of it, he looked like a wild person, with ripped up closing all over him. He had long and messy green hair. Overall, he resembled Nagare’s definition of a forest barbarian. Yet, he had a sword by his side. It was longer than Nagare’s, providing much larger reach, with its blade shining with light green hue.
He was cooking chopped up green meat over bonfire.
“You can come out now. I can tell you are watching me”
Nagare: “*Comes out of hiding*. Very well”
Nagare: “Nagare Shirosaki, class 1 demon hunter of Order of Hunters. Identify yourself!”
“Sheesh, so uptight, are you not?”
Using a crutch, he gradually lifted himself up.
One of his legs was heavily bandaged up and bleeding, but he still managed to make an awkward bow.
“I am Jin Fu. Guardian of Wind, Order of Hunters. Very nice to meet you, Nagare san”
